I went over to a friend house today cause he said his computer was doing some weird stuff. I sat down and turned the computer on and it rans through the post-test stuff just fine. The Windows Background loaded but then a COMCTL32.DLL error loaded and I closed the error box and nothing really happens. It just sits there with the background. I ran scandisk through dos and a few errors were fixed but it loads the error again.
I then went into dos and checked his C: and everything is still there so nothing has been lost.
I tried to run ME in safemode and it still pops up with the error.
My question is what do I do so I can get it to load properly and then burn my friends stuff to CD and reformat the hard drive. I would normally just want it fixed but his HD was full of 'stuff' before this error occured.
